What Makes a 4 Wire Smoke Detector Different?
A 4 wire smoke detector is a type of fire detection device that uses four separate wires—two for power and two for sending the alarm signal. This simple setup makes it reliable for both new and old buildings.
The detector keeps checking the air around it. When it senses smoke, it sends a signal to the fire alarm panel, helping the system respond quickly.
These detectors are known for:
Stable performance
Easy maintenance
Better compatibility with many alarm panels
Strong response during early smoke stages
Because of these benefits, many safety engineers prefer these detectors for commercial setups.
Does Your Building Need a 4 Wire Smoke Detector?
Every building has different fire safety needs. But these detectors are most helpful in:
Office buildings
Warehouses
Schools and colleges
Hospitals and clinics
Manufacturing units
Shopping stores
Apartments with mixed-use areas
If your building has long wiring runs, older fire alarm panels, or many separate zones, a 4 wire smoke detector can improve safety without changing the full system.
Local fire rules often recommend early smoke detection in high-risk areas. This makes using a reliable smoke detector even more important. You can check your building’s fire safety report or consult your fire maintenance team to confirm needs.

FAQs
1. What is a 4 wire smoke detector?
It is a detector that uses four wires—two for power and two for sending alarm signals to the fire control panel.
2. Are 4 wire smoke detectors suitable for old buildings?
Yes, they work well with many older panels and long wiring runs.
3. How often should these detectors be tested?
Testing once every month and cleaning every six months is recommended.
